plc编程员面试要问些什么软件

fiy 其他 3

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在PLC编程员面试中,可以询问以下软件相关的问题:

    1. PLC编程软件:询问应聘者是否熟悉常用的PLC编程软件,如Siemens STEP 7、Rockwell Studio 5000、Schneider Unity Pro等。可以进一步询问他们在这些软件上的使用经验和熟悉程度。

    2. HMI软件:了解应聘者是否熟悉人机界面(HMI)软件,如Siemens WinCC、Rockwell FactoryTalk View、Schneider Vijeo Designer等。询问他们是否能够创建和配置HMI界面,并与PLC进行通信。

    3. 数据采集软件:询问应聘者是否熟悉数据采集软件,如Wonderware InTouch、Kepware等。了解他们是否有经验在PLC系统中实现数据采集和监控功能。

    4. 数据处理软件:询问应聘者是否熟悉数据处理软件,如Microsoft Excel、SQL数据库等。了解他们是否能够处理和分析从PLC系统中获取的数据,并生成报表或进行数据分析。

    5. 程序仿真软件:询问应聘者是否熟悉PLC程序仿真软件,如Siemens S7-PLCSIM、Rockwell Emulate等。了解他们是否能够使用仿真软件验证和调试PLC程序。

    6. 特殊软件需求:根据公司的特殊需求,询问应聘者是否熟悉其他特定的软件,如SCADA系统软件、MES系统软件等。了解他们是否有相关的使用经验。

    除了以上软件相关的问题,还可以询问应聘者对软件开发流程、版本控制、故障排除等方面的理解和经验。这些问题可以帮助评估应聘者的技术能力和适应能力,以确定其是否适合PLC编程员的职位。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    当面试PLC编程员时,可以问以下几个问题,以评估其软件方面的技能和经验:

    1. PLC编程软件:询问候选人熟悉的PLC编程软件是哪些,例如Siemens STEP 7、Rockwell RSLogix 5000、Schneider Unity Pro等。了解他们在使用这些软件方面的经验和熟练程度。

    2. 编程语言:询问候选人熟悉的PLC编程语言是什么,例如Ladder Logic、Structured Text、Function Block Diagram等。了解他们对不同编程语言的掌握程度和能力。

    3. 编程经验:询问候选人在PLC编程方面的工作经验,包括他们曾经完成的项目和使用的编程技术。了解他们在实际项目中的应用能力和解决问题的能力。

    4. 调试和故障排除:询问候选人在调试和故障排除方面的经验和技能。了解他们解决PLC程序错误和故障的能力,以及他们使用的调试工具和技术。

    5. 网络通信:询问候选人在PLC网络通信方面的知识和经验。了解他们对PLC与其他设备之间通信协议的了解程度,如Modbus、Ethernet/IP等。

    此外,还可以根据公司的具体需求和项目要求问一些定制的问题,以确保候选人具备所需的软件技能和知识。同时,可以要求候选人进行编程测试或解决实际案例,以评估他们的实际能力和解决问题的能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在PLC编程员面试时,可以问一些与软件相关的问题,以评估候选人的技能和经验。以下是一些常见的软件问题:

    1. PLC编程软件:请列举您熟悉和使用过的PLC编程软件。

      • 候选人应该能够列出他们在PLC编程方面使用过的软件,如Siemens TIA Portal、Rockwell Studio 5000、Mitsubishi GX Works等。他们还应该能够描述他们对这些软件的熟练程度和经验。
    2. 编程语言:您在PLC编程中使用的主要编程语言是什么?

      • 候选人应该能够列出他们熟悉和使用的主要PLC编程语言,如Ladder Logic(梯形图)、Structured Text(结构化文本)、Function Block Diagram(功能块图)等。他们还应该能够描述他们对每种语言的熟悉程度和经验。
    3. 编程调试:请描述您在PLC编程调试方面的经验。

      • 候选人应该能够解释他们在调试PLC程序时所采取的方法和步骤。他们应该能够描述他们如何检查和修复编程错误,如何使用调试工具和功能,以及如何与其他团队成员合作解决问题。
    4. 界面设计:您是否有设计和开发PLC HMI界面的经验?

      • 候选人应该能够描述他们在设计和开发PLC HMI界面方面的经验。他们应该能够解释他们使用过的HMI软件和工具,以及他们如何创建用户友好的界面和图形。
    5. 数据管理:请描述您在PLC数据管理方面的经验。

      • 候选人应该能够解释他们在PLC数据管理方面的经验,包括他们如何收集和存储数据,如何创建和维护数据表,以及如何与数据库和其他系统集成。
    6. 网络通信:请描述您在PLC网络通信方面的经验。

      • 候选人应该能够解释他们在PLC网络通信方面的经验,包括他们如何配置和管理PLC网络连接,如何使用协议和接口进行数据通信,以及他们如何解决网络故障和安全问题。
    7. 版本控制:请描述您在PLC程序版本控制方面的经验。

      • 候选人应该能够解释他们在PLC程序版本控制方面的经验,包括他们如何使用版本控制软件(如Git)来管理和跟踪PLC程序的变化,以及他们如何处理并解决版本冲突。
    8. 文档编写:请描述您在编写PLC程序文档方面的经验。

      • 候选人应该能够解释他们在编写PLC程序文档方面的经验,包括他们如何记录程序设计和功能说明,如何创建用户手册和操作指南,以及他们如何与团队成员共享和更新文档。

    通过询问这些问题,面试官可以评估候选人在PLC编程软件方面的技能和经验,以确定他们是否适合担任PLC编程员的职位。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部